牵引变电站自动化系统的通信技术
黄慧汇,陈维荣
作者单位
摘要:
针对电气化铁路牵引变电站的实际情况,结合变电站自动化系统的发展趋势,详细讨论了分层分布式牵引变电站的站内通信及与远方调度中心的通信。站内采用LonWork测控网与以太网两级通信机制,多个变电站与调度中心采用DDN方式组网通信。分析及现场试验有力地表明,该方案能满足变电站自动化系统对通信的高可靠性、灵活性和实时性的要求,为进一步实现变电站无人值班打下良好基础。
关键词:  电气化铁路 牵引变电站 自动化系统 通信

Communication Technology in Traction Substation Automatio n System
HUANG Hui hui  CHEN Wei rong
Abstract:
According to the realities of electrified railway traction substation and the development tendency of substation automation system,the internal communication of a hierarchic distributed traction substation and its communication with remote control center are discussed in detail.Dual level communication network of LonWorks and ethernet is used in internal communication,and DDN is used to construct the communication network for substations and control center.Analysis and experiment prove that the needs of substation automation system for reliability,flexibility and real time performance can be met preferably.Furthermore,the solid foundation for unmanned substation can be laid.
Key words:  traction substation,substation automation,field bus,ethernet,communication,
